Nestled on a large lot, (room for a pool!) and only 4 minutes from Harbor Town Marina, on Lake Allatoona (an easy bike ride or leisurely walk away), lies this completely renovated 5 bed, 3.5 bath farmhouse. From the new metal roof to the brand new decks and porch, this home is move in ready! Inside you will find open concept main floor living where no surface has gone untouched! The home boasts a brand new kitchen complete with a brand new 5 burner 36" chefs range and oven, complete with breakfast area. Add to that, 3.5 completely renovated bathrooms, a main floor owner's retreat with its own private deck, 3 large upstairs bedrooms with laundry space on the upper floor as well as on the terrace level. Head down to the newly added flex space on the terrace level, which includes a 5th bedroom and full bath, with a possible 6th bedroom or home office as well as a 2 car garage. No portion of this home remains untouched. Make your lake living dreams come true!

R20
Single-Family Residential District
The purpose of this residential district is to permit and encourage development of medium density for sale single-family residential uses and for sale communities in a moderately spacious surrounding. The R-20 development district shall be served with an approved community water system.
